Add Toast.ane file to your air project.
-
Add com.aratush.ane.Toast extension id to your application descriptor file. For example:
<!-- Identifies the ActionScript extensions used by an application. -->
<extensions>
<extensionID>com.aratush.ane.Toast</extensionID>
</extensions>
import com.aratush.ane.toast.DurationEnum;
import com.aratush.ane.toast.GravityEnum;
import com.aratush.ane.toast.ToastExtension;
if (ToastExtension.isSupported)
{
var toast:ToastExtension = new ToastExtension();
toast.setText("Hello");
toast.setDuration(DurationEnum.LENGTH_LONG);
toast.setGravity(GravityEnum.CENTER, 100, 50);
toast.show();
// close the toast
toast.cancel();
}
ToastExtension.isSupported
- check whether Toast extension is supported on your platform.setText()
- set the text in a Toast.setDuration()
- set how long to show the view for it.setGravity()
- set the location at which the notification should appear on the screen.show()
- show the Toast for the specified parameters.cancel()
- close the view if it's showing.
NOTE: For setDuration()
and setGravity()
methods use DurationEnum and GravityEnum classes respectively.
